The company's infrastructure is extensive, including over 11,100 kilometers of high-voltage transmission lines. This network connects ZESCO to the Southern African Power Pool (SAPP), providing the corporation with an extended power trading market, security of power supplies, and power generation pooling. This interconnected system is managed by an automated system at its National Control Centre (NCC), which monitors and controls the vast network to enhance operational efficiency and security.
